1. What are the advantages of Bluetooth® Mesh technology compared to other wireless communication protocols in automation?
Bluetooth® Mesh offers a fully distributed network, eliminating single points of failure and improving system resilience—especially in large deployments like commercial buildings. It also uses end-to-end encryption, ensuring robust security at every node. Unlike proprietary protocols, Bluetooth® Mesh guarantees interoperability across certified devices, thanks to the Bluetooth SIG.

2. How can organizations mitigate cybersecurity risks associated with cloud-based smart building systems?
One effective strategy is to shift toward edge computing. By processing data locally, organizations reduce dependence on the cloud and limit exposure to external threats. Subnets and virtual cloud partitions add isolation layers—so if one segment is compromised, the rest stay secure. This supports a zero-trust model and keeps sensitive data close to its source. 3. How can edge computing strengthen cybersecurity defenses while improving data processing efficiency?
Edge computing enables local data processing, reducing latency and avoiding unnecessary cloud transmission of sensitive information. This not only speeds up response times for critical functions but also shrinks the external attack surface. It gives organizations more control over data flow and better alignment with privacy regulations. 4. What are the key challenges organizations face when transitioning to smart automation, and how can they be addressed?
Key obstacles include operational disruptions, high Capex, and integration issues between legacy systems. These can be mitigated with modular, wireless mesh solutions that allow phased upgrades with minimal downtime. Open standards and interoperable systems reduce friction and expand the value across building technologies.

5. How can IoT-enabled automation improve energy efficiency while maintaining occupant comfort?
By unifying lighting, HVAC, and plug loads under a single control system, IoT enables real-time, occupancy-driven energy optimization. A centralized dashboard gives facility managers the visibility to fine-tune performance without sacrificing comfort. Integrating multiple sensing technologies across all building loads can drive energy savings of up to 30%—without compromising the occupant experience.
6. How can organizations balance the high upfront costs of smart building upgrades with long-term energy savings?
Wireless mesh infrastructure helps cut installation costs by avoiding expensive rewiring. Beyond energy efficiency, smart systems deliver value through features like predictive maintenance, indoor air quality monitoring, and circadian lighting—all of which enhance occupant well-being and productivity.
Technologies like Luminaire Level Lighting Controls (LLLC) can slash upgrade costs by up to 70%, making smart buildings more accessible and cost-effective.
